Handover note — Crumbwheel order cutoffs.

Welcome aboard. The bakery cutoff rule in Crumbwheel closes same-day orders at 14:00 local to each storefront, not UTC — this has bitten us twice. Holiday overrides live in the calendar service and take precedence silently, so always check there first when a cutoff looks wrong. To unlock the calendar service's admin console after a restart, enter the recovery passphrase below.

vault phrase of bagap-bahaf = silion-pelox-sorox-casdor-quenwyn-fraax-eliox-praael-kelion-quenvan-kasox-rusael-norius-belvan

Handover Note — Director Transition, Merrowgate Expansion. To the finance team: as I pass responsibility for the Merrowgate regional expansion to Director Alis Fenn, please note the current state. Site leases in Corvale are signed; fit-out budgets are 60% committed. Hiring forecasts were revised downward in March and should be treated as the baseline. Currency exposure on supplier contracts remains unhedged — prioritize this. The strategic framing Alis should carry forward appears below.

board note of hafog-kafop: Only 50 of the 505 pilot accounts renewed Eliys, so a churn review is set for April 7. Fravanox Partners is in early talks to buy Tamvanix Logistics for about $273.9 million.

## Artifact Signing — Watchdog Builds

The Lanternview kiosk watchdog is updated independently of the main app, so its artifacts carry their own signing chain. Every build from the Corbel pipeline must be signed before the kiosks' bootloader will accept it; unsigned binaries trigger a rollback to the last known-good image. Keep the trust store and this page in sync whenever rotation occurs. Verify all watchdog artifacts against the following key.

deploy key for kajof-fajop: bky6_gDHw9Q

**Q3 Planning Note — Logistics Provider Change**

For the incoming director: we are exiting our agreement with Torvane Haulage and onboarding Ashgrove Logistics across the Penderly corridor. Transition completes mid-quarter with dual-running for three weeks. Expected annualised saving is material; service levels are contractually tighter. Background on the wider plan follows below.

internal memo for kawip-hadug: Headcount on the Wenwyn team goes from 7 to 140 by the end of January. Gross margin on Wenwyn came in at 20 percent against a plan of 15 percent.